Transaction 9037d0117ea7be54786e0325f50980c10bc1469c43e127de0d52e6bdd33108e5

1 Input
2 Outputs
  • 9037d0117ea7be54786e0325f50980c10bc1469c43e127de0d52e6bdd33108e5:0
  • value  36242699
    address  18WaFVVgzUntFx6ABKCnHw4eEBq2zfoEGt
  • 9037d0117ea7be54786e0325f50980c10bc1469c43e127de0d52e6bdd33108e5:1
  • value  590356
    address  33SPYyUrhosHgzDay14wyNHq9nKbgcvPoh